On 08/25/2010 03:50 PM, Christoph Lameter wrote:
> Can we just get rid of the special UP case and just run the percpu
> subsystem even for UP?

Yeah, maybe.  Then we also can guarantee that percpu allocator always
honors alignment (which wq code currently requires and papers over
with similarly ugly workaround).  It would add a mostly redundant
allocator code tho.  I'll look into how easily it can be done.
